|Equinix (Founded in 1998)|- Equinix is often regarded as one of the first companies to establish large-scale, commercial datacenters designed for interconnecting different organizations' networks. It was founded during the dotcom boom and became a leader in datacenter interconnection and colocation services.</br>- Equinix opened its first datacenter in Silicon Valley in 1999, and it quickly expanded with other locations across the U.S. and globally. They provided secure, reliable hosting for the rapidly growing internet infrastructure and began offering colocation services, where businesses could rent space to house their own servers.|
